Bearwood Primary School was originally built in 1847, with the original building being Grade II listed. Its history is linked with the Walter family of Bearwood House. We have a well-equipped and resourced building, spacious grounds and a dedicated, knowledgeable and hardworking team of staff whose aim is to do the best for each child.
We are a 1.5 form-entry maintained local authority school, with children from Foundation Stage (age 3) right through to Year 6 (age 11). We are a GOOD school on our journey to becoming Outstanding.
